Steps to Start Betting Safely

Starting with online sports betting involves a few straightforward steps. First, choose an operator that holds a valid license from the Spanish authorities. Licensed platforms adhere to stringent standards for fairness, data security, and responsible gambling policies. After selecting a site, create an account by providing basic personal information, then verify your identity as required by law. Verification often involves submitting a photo ID and proof of address to prevent fraud and ensure compliance.

Next, set a budget. It’s easy to underestimate how quickly bets can add up. Limits safeguard against potential financial losses and help keep the activity enjoyable. Once your account is funded through a secure payment method, you’re set to explore the available markets, from football and basketball to esports and niche sports.

Utilizing Responsible Gambling Tools

One of the most important aspects of starting online betting responsibly is utilizing available tools to manage your activity. These include setting deposit limits, session timeouts, and self-exclusion options. Many platforms, including those operating in Spain, have dedicated responsible gambling pages to help you establish boundaries.

Moreover, regularly reviewing your betting history and staying within your pre-set budget can prevent issues from escalating. If you recognize signs of problematic gambling, seeking support early can make a significant difference. Remember, betting should be a form of entertainment, not a way to solve financial problems or escape personal issues.
